Two things just became true at once
Anyone can weaponize an AI. Nobody stops them.
Trim the safety limits off an open model, point it at a target, and it attacks at machine speed. The Hugging Face agent chained a malicious dataset into code execution, escalated to node-level access, harvested cloud and cluster credentials, and moved laterally over a single weekend. No human throttled the pace.
Your forensic tools will refuse to help.
When Hugging Face investigated, the commercial models it tried to use blocked the work. Their guardrails cannot tell an incident responder from an attacker. A defender who depends only on a hosted API can be locked out of investigating their own breach at the worst possible moment.
“The analysis requires submitting large volumes of real attack commands, exploit payloads, and C2 artifacts, and these requests were blocked by the providers' safety guardrails, which cannot distinguish an incident responder from an attacker.”
Hugging Face incident disclosure, July 2026. They ran the forensics on a self-hosted open model instead.

What we actually test on your side
Every stage of the breach maps to a question about your environment. We answer each one with proof, not opinion.
| Breach stage | The question we answer for you |
|---|---|
| Initial accessA malicious dataset ran code on a processing worker. | Which of your data and model ingestion paths can execute attacker-controlled code, proven with a benign payload. |
| EscalationThe agent escalated from the worker to node-level access. | How far one compromised process reaches, walked to node and control-plane. |
| Credential harvestIt harvested cloud and cluster credentials. | Every service account, token, and CI credential a worker can read, with its real blast radius. |
| Lateral movementIt moved into several internal clusters over a weekend. | The concrete lateral and privilege-escalation chains, and the chokepoints that break them. |
| Machine-speed tempoThousands of actions across a swarm of short-lived sandboxes. | How fast your detection and containment actually fire, timed against an un-restricted agent. |
| ForensicsCommercial models refused to analyze the real attack data. | A self-hosted model you control that never refuses the investigation. |
